16y-24=4y what is the value of Y ?

Let's solve your equation step-by-step.

16y−24=4y

Step 1: Subtract 4y from both sides.

16y−24−4y=4y−4y

12y−24=0

Step 2: Add 24 to both sides.

12y−24+24=0+24

12y=24

Step 3: Divide both sides by 12.

12y /12

=

24 /12

y=2

Answer:

y=2
